A choral piece of remembrance; written for the Day of the Dead.

Music and lyrics by Anne Bertran and Aaron Walter.

To the lost, to the found, to the outcast and unbound: Let us sing, let us weep, let us give you peace to sleep. Let our flame light your way, we will guide you through the maze Whether well known or nameless, we remember your face.

Oh, farewell! Come hear the bell! Your tale we shall tell, farewell. (x2)

We build kingdoms of remembrance, we sing rapture remade. When night comes for you sibling, we'll remember your day. Raise your voice, raise your voice, don your virtues and veils Let the dead reach the living in the solace of bells.

Oh, farewell! Come hear the bell! Your tale we shall tell, farewell. (x2)
